IFS COATINGS INC Sales Engineer - Custom Industrial Oven Systems in GAINESVILLE, Texas
We are a fast-growing, specialized manufacturer ofcustom gas catalytic infrared ovensused in industrial curing, finishing, and thermal processing applications. We pride ourselves on engineering excellence, energy efficiency, and a customer-focused approach. As a small company, every team member plays a vital role in delivering high-performance systems that solve complex challenges for manufacturers across North America.
Position Summary:
We are seeking a technically savvy and customer-focusedSales Engineerto support the sales process by bridging the gap between engineering and customer needs. This role is responsible for identifying new business opportunities, developing technical proposals, and providing application-specific solutions for industrial clients. Ideal candidates will combine strong communication skills with a solid background inengineering, manufacturing, or industrial equipment.
This is ahands-on rolefor someone who enjoys working with custom systems, building client relationships, and helping customers solve problems with engineered solutions.
Key Responsibilities:
Sales and Business Development
- Identify, qualify, and develop relationships with industrial customers in target markets.
- Conduct discovery calls, site visits, and application assessments to understand customer needs.
- Present technical product solutions and communicate the value of our infrared oven systems.
Technical Proposal Development
- Collaborate with engineering and project management teams to develop quotes, system layouts, and technical proposals.
- Prepare and deliver detailed cost estimates, scope of supply documents, and RFQ responses.
- Support configuration of custom systems, including sizing, heat profiles, and process flow.
Customer Relationship Management
- Serve as the primary point of contact throughout the sales cycle, from first contact through project handoff.
- Educate clients on gas catalytic technology and help them evaluate ROI, efficiency, and performance benefits.
- Maintain records in CRM tools, track opportunity pipelines, and follow up regularly with prospects.
Travel and Industry Engagement
- Travel to customer sites for meetings, plant walkthroughs, and installations (as needed, up to 60%).
- Attend trade shows, industry events, and conferences (e.g.,FABTECH).
- Provide market feedback to help guide product development and business strategy.
